Ingredients
For the Beignet Dough:
-
3 ½ cups all-purpose flour
-
¼ cup granulated sugar
-
1 teaspoon active dry yeast
-
1 cup warm milk (about 110°F)
-
2 large eggs
-
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
-
¼ cup unsalted butter, melted
-
1 teaspoon salt
-
Vegetable oil, for frying
For the Topping:
-
Powdered sugar, for dusting
Instructions
-
Prepare the Dough: In a bowl, combine warm milk and yeast. Let it sit for about 5 minutes until the mixture is frothy and bubbly.
-
Mix Ingredients: In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, granulated sugar, and salt. Add the eggs, vanilla extract, melted butter, and the yeast mixture. Mix until smooth.
-
Rise the Dough: Cover the dough with a damp cloth and let it rise for 1-2 hours, or until it has doubled in size.
-
Shape Beignets: Once the dough has risen, turn it out onto a floured surface. Roll it out to about ½ inch thickness and cut into squares or rectangles.
-
Fry Beignets: Heat vegetable oil in a large pot to 350°F (175°C). Fry the beignets in batches, for about 2-3 minutes per side or until golden brown and crispy.
-
Drain & Dust: Remove the beignets from the oil and place them on paper towels to drain. While they are still warm, dust with powdered sugar.
-
Serve: Serve the warm, fluffy Vanilla French Beignets with a hot beverage or as a sweet dessert. Enjoy!
Notes
-
For Extra Flavor: You can add a touch of cinnamon or nutmeg to the dough for added warmth and spice.
-
Alternative Toppings: While powdered sugar is the classic topping, you can drizzle them with a chocolate glaze or a vanilla glaze for an extra indulgent treat.
-
Storage: These beignets are best enjoyed fresh but can be stored in an airtight container for up to 2 days.
